1. This document discusses several methods for calculating solutions that are isotonic with blood and tears, including the freezing point depression method, NaCl equivalent method, White Vincent method, Sprowl method, and others.
2. The freezing point depression method involves calculating the weight of substance needed to make a solution isotonic based on the freezing point depression of the substance.
3. The NaCl equivalent method uses sodium chloride equivalents to convert the concentration of other substances to an equivalent sodium chloride concentration to achieve isotonicity.
